Question
I have a small coldwater aquarium kept where the temperature may drop as low as 60F.  I have White Clouds in the tank, and am having trouble cleaning up uneaten food.  It's making the water cloudy.  Could I introduce a bottom-feeding species that will help to clean the uneaten food? Is this the best solution?

Answer
Hi John:... the best solution is to gravel vacuum before the ammonia builds up so high you have fish loss... bottom feeders and algae eaters do a good job but they don't do a great job... you can purchase a gravel vacuum for about $12 at the local aquarium...
